What To Expect

The Chattanooga Tunnels Extended Guided Tour is a 3.5-hour exploration of the city's hidden underground network, blending historical insights with both driving and walking elements. Starting at Ross's Landing, the tour covers significant tunnel locations, including the Walnut Street Bridge, Cameron Hill, and the Chattanooga Choo Choo Complex. Participants will delve into the tunnels' roles during the Civil War, their use in the Prohibition era, and their importance to the city's rail and industrial development. The tour also includes a lunch break at a local eatery and visits to the Bluff View Art District and the St. Elmo neighborhood. The experience concludes with a visit to a Civil War site, highlighting the tunnels' strategic importance during the Battle of Chattanooga, before returning to the starting point at Ross's Landing.
